greasemonkey
idつきheadingへのリンクを追加するgreasemonkey November 07, 2006 05:49
- Permalink
- Comments (1928)
- Trackbacks (0)
greasemonkey
■みたいの用意しなきゃいけないのはブラウザが悪いよな。 あ、それGre(ry
てことでしょーもないけどGreasemonkeyスクリプトを作ってみた。 1日1回はプログラミングしないと!
h1〜h5でidがついてるとその要素の始めのところに「_」っていうリンクを追加するだけ。 こういうのやっぱりページ作成者じゃなくてブラウザ側でやるべきだね。 だってそうしないとインタフェース統一されんもん。
なんかgetElementsByTagNameが返すのはArrayじゃないね? はまっちった。 JavaScriptでオブジェクトのクラス名を知るにはどうしたらいいんだろう。
で、ときどき
Component returned failure code: 0x80520012 (NS_ERROR_FILE_NOT_FOUND) [nsIChannel.open]
てゆうエラーになるんだけど、とりあえず深追いするのはやめた……。
あとspidermonkeyはなんで
js> [1,2,3] 1,2,3 js> "1,2,3" 1,2,3
配列と文字列で表示が同じなんだろう。誤解するだろ……。
はてブのブックマークを複数のタグで絞り込むgreasemonkey January 12, 2006 05:13
- Permalink
- Comments (2296)
- Trackbacks (0)
greasemonkey
はてなブックマークはブックマークに対して検索ができますが、これ、タグも検索対象になるので タグで検索すれば複数のタグで絞り込んだことになるじゃんていう、しょうもないネタです。
( ・∀・)つ[Multi Tags Search]
greasemonkeyのスクリプトです。Firefox 1.0.7/greasemonkey 0.6.3/Win XPとFirefox 1.5/greasemonkey 0.6.4/Linuxで一応動作確認してます。
このスクリプトは、クリックしたタグを勝手に検索窓にコピーしやがります。うまくいけば。 はてブのブックマークを複数のタグで絞り込むのを助けるgreasemonkeyです。
インストールすると、はてブの検索窓が少し変わります。
試しに、読んでいないプログラミング関係のブックマークを見付けるために、 「あとで読む」タグをクリックしてみます。 すると検索窓はこうなります。
「あとで読む」タグのついたブックマークがあまりに多すぎたのでw、ここから探すのは大変です。 この中からプログラミングに関するものを読みたいので、 「プログラミング」タグをクリックしてみます。すると検索窓はこうなります。
ここで「検索」ボタンを押すと……
「あとで読む」「プログラミング」の2つのタグでブックマークを絞ることができました。
検索窓のタグはしつこく残るんですが、「Clear」ボタンを押すか、ブックマークのトップページ (例えばhttp://b.hatena.ne.jp/yzatkatamayu/) に行くと消えます。
うーん、普段JavaScriptやらないから、4時間もかかった。エントリは結構見てるんだけどなぁ。
